Default How to keep central console touch screen clean?

(Not for the first time I wish there were non-model-specific categories .. .. we could visit .. ..)
I usually clean the central console touch screen by breathing on it then wiping with a dry cotton cloth. Twice usually works. But in no time any dust / fingerprints / smears are all too evident. I don't want to use a compound (soap? polish?) in case the finish either attracts dust and dirt [even more], becomes insufficiently sensitive to touch, builds up, or whatever.
Any ideas?

Its not actually a touch screen but you try hovering your finger a mm or less above it. But because its not a touch screen you can action all functions with your finger wrapped in a cloth! May help. Other than that yeah a fingerprint and dust magnet - could be worse, look at the ridiculous number of screens in the new A8/Q8 etc

I bought a glass screen protector like you get for phones which has a coating on it, reduces the number of prints quite a lot, I then use either the Volvo micro fibre cloth that came with my car or a micro fibre cleaning mitt when I clean the rest of the interior.

If it really bothers you, there are screen protectors with a matte finish that are pretty good at resisting the appearance of finger marks. You'd have to get one for a large tablet - iPad Pro or similar - and cut down to size.

I agree with JS90. However, I managed to get a matte screen protector designed specifically for the Sensus screen. I can't remember which one I bought, but it's still in the car and works well for preventing both fingerprints and glare.
